Transaction a10156296faee5071c71c6efcb98d1bab1eabd2b4374e39e121cdaf5b9f50074
1 Input
1 Output
-
a10156296faee5071c71c6efcb98d1bab1eabd2b4374e39e121cdaf5b9f50074:0
- value
- 299252
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 53365bb99108c959ae0e843010ddf133947735f9 OP_EQUAL
- address
- 39H18M4CRhFS8JY2owv6Gzfr2onuuh2CtT